Shayne Blackman

Tiga Bayles interviews National Administrator of the Uniting Church Aboriginal & Islander Christian Congress Rev Shayne Blackman. They talk about the national developments driven by Uniting Aboriginal & Islander Christian Congress, education, training and employment opportunities, sporting initiatives, church power and government and much more. Linda Burney

Tiga Bayles interviews NSW MP and Minister Linda Burney. Following the March state election Premier Morris Iemma has appointed Linda Burney as the new NSW Minister for Volunteering, Fair Trading and Youth.
